Please ensure Javascript is enabled for purposes of website accessibility Skip to content

VIEW BY TOPIC

FOLLOW US

Related Posts

Ready to Grow Your Business Fast?

Here’s How I Grew Five Businesses, and Eventually Sold One to a Fortune 500 Company.

android developer, small business coach

Hiring an Android Developer in Different Ecosystems

In the tech world, the decision to hire an Android developer is crucial and varies greatly between startups and corporate environments. Each ecosystem has distinct requirements and offers unique opportunities.

Hiring an Android developer is more than just a simple recruitment choice in the current fast-paced technology landscape. It is a strategic decision with significant implications for different business environments- startups and corporates. This decision significantly affects the immediate team and the broader trajectory of the company’s technological journey.

Startups: Agility and Innovation with an Android Developer

Startups are known for their agility and innovation, seeking Android developers who are adaptable, creative, and versatile.

Cross-functional Collaboration

In startups, android developers often collaborate with teams across different functions, providing a holistic understanding of the business. This cross-functional exposure is invaluable for professional growth and innovation.

Innovative Environment: 

Startups are hotbeds for cutting-edge technology, allowing developers to work on groundbreaking projects and potentially disrupt markets.

Growth and Learning Opportunities: 

android developer

The startup environment offers a steep learning curve. Developers can quickly gain experience in various business and technology aspects, which is beneficial for their career growth.

Corporate: Stability and Specialization

Corporates provide a stable and structured environment, focusing on specialization and expertise.

In-depth Expertise: Corporations encourage developers to specialize deeply in specific areas, leading to high-quality outputs and expertise.

Advanced Resources: Corporates often have access to state-of-the-art tools and technologies, providing developers with an environment to work on large-scale, impactful projects.

Global Exposure: Working in large corporations can offer developers exposure to global markets and practices, enhancing their understanding of different business environments.

Hiring Processes and Practices

The approach to hiring in startups versus corporations often reflects the distinct cultures and needs of these environments.

Cultural Fit vs. Experience with an Android Developer

Startups, with their fast-paced and often unpredictable environments, usually place a high value on cultural fit, potential, and diverse skill sets. This preference stems from the need for employees who can adapt quickly to changing circumstances, embrace the company’s ethos, and contribute to a collaborative and innovative atmosphere. For instance, a startup might favor a candidate who demonstrates a strong entrepreneurial spirit and a willingness to take on varied responsibilities, even if they lack extensive experience in Android development.

On the other hand, corporations generally prioritize experience and a proven track record. They often seek candidates who have demonstrated their ability in similar environments, valuing the depth of knowledge and expertise that comes with specialized experience. Corporations might favor candidates who have worked on large-scale projects or who have a strong background in a specific area of Android development, such as UI/UX design, backend development, or security.

Compensation Structures

In startups, compensation often includes equity or stock options. This approach not only helps startups attract talent in competitive markets but also aligns employees’ interests with the long-term success of the company. Equity packages can be highly lucrative if the startup succeeds, offering employees a share in the company’s potential growth.

Corporations, in contrast, tend to offer higher salaries and comprehensive benefit packages. These packages might include health insurance, retirement plans, and bonuses. The stability and predictability of such compensation can be attractive, especially for individuals looking for long-term financial security.

Career Pathways for an Android Developer

Startups offer dynamic and sometimes rapid career progression. The fluid structure of startups allows employees to take on diverse roles and responsibilities, fostering a fast-paced learning environment. This can be particularly appealing for individuals looking to grow their skill set and advance quickly in their careers.

Corporations offer more predictable and structured career paths. Employees in corporations can expect a more traditional trajectory, often with clearly defined roles and a hierarchy that provides a roadmap for advancement. This structure can be reassuring for individuals who prefer stability and a clear sense of direction in their careers.

Market Trends and Technological Adaptability

Startups are often at the forefront of adopting and responding to market trends and emerging technologies. They rely on developers who quickly adapt and innovate, helping the company stay ahead in a competitive market. For instance, a startup might rapidly pivot to incorporate AI or machine learning into their products, requiring developers who can quickly learn and apply these technologies.

Corporations might prioritize developers with expertise in established technologies, focusing on long-term strategic goals and stability. They often require developers who can maintain and enhance existing systems, ensuring they remain reliable and effective over time.

Remote Work and Diverse Talent Pools

The rise of remote work has significantly expanded the talent pool for both startups and corporations. Startups often embrace remote work more naturally, allowing them to tap into a global talent pool and build diverse teams. This approach can bring in a range of perspectives and skills, fostering a more creative and inclusive work culture.

Corporations are also adopting remote work but often with more structured policies and procedures. These policies are designed to ensure effective collaboration and team cohesion, even when employees are spread across different locations. Corporations might use technology and formal processes to maintain communication and collaboration among remote teams.

Balancing Technical Skills and Soft Skills with an Android Developer

android developer for your business

In hiring an Android developer, both startups and corporations need to find a balance between technical prowess and soft skills. In startups, developers often work in smaller, more integrated teams, requiring strong communication and collaboration skills. The ability to work well in a team, adapt to changing priorities, and contribute to a positive work culture is highly valued.

In corporations, while technical skills are crucial, soft skills like leadership, strategic thinking, and the ability to manage teams or interface with different business units are also important. These skills help ensure that developers can work effectively within larger organizations, contributing to team dynamics and broader business objectives.

Evolving Roles for an Android Developer

The role of an Android developer is continually evolving, shaped by advancements in technology like AI, machine learning, and cybersecurity. In startups, developers might be expected to quickly adapt to these new technologies, integrating them into innovative applications. This requires a willingness to learn and experiment, often working on the cutting edge of technology.

In corporations, developers focus more on how these technologies can be scaled and secured within large user bases and complex systems. This often involves a more methodical and systematic approach, ensuring that new technologies are implemented in a way that is sustainable and secure.

Conclusion: Matching the Right Talent with the Right Environment

Whether hiring an Android developer for a startup or a corporate entity, it’s crucial to align with the specific needs and culture of the organization. Startups offer a dynamic and versatile environment ideal for developers who thrive on innovation and adaptability. Corporates, on the other hand, provide a structured and specialized setting suited for those who excel in stability and depth of expertise. Understanding these nuances is key to successful hiring and the long-term success of technology projects.

small business coach